What Are Soffit Boards?

Soffit boards are the panels that bridge the gap in between the roof eaves and the walls of a structure. They serve numerous functions:

Fascia-and-Soffit-Replacement.png
  1. Ventilation: Soffits enable for air blood circulation in the attic space, lowering moisture buildup and avoiding mold and rot.

  2. Visual appeals: Soffit boards give the outside of a home a finished and aesthetically appealing look.

  3. Security: They protect structural aspects from the elements, insects, and wetness invasion.

Types of Soffit Boards

When thinking about changing soffit boards, various materials and types are offered-- each with its own set of advantages and drawbacks. Below is a table showcasing the most common options:

TypeProductProsCons
VinylPVCLow Roofline Maintenance, resistant to wetness, available in various colorsCan become breakable in severe temperature levels
AluminumAluminumDurable, light-weight, resistant to rustCan dent, might be more pricey than vinyl
WoodStrong wood or plywoodVisual appeal, can be painted or stainedGreater maintenance, vulnerable to rot and pests
Fiber CementCement and celluloseFire-resistant, extremely durable, mimics wood lookHeavier, requires professional installation

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. For how long do soffit boards last?

The life expectancy of soffit boards differs by material. Vinyl and aluminum boards can last upwards of 30 years with correct maintenance, while wood boards might last 10-15 years if well taken care of.

2. Can I replace soffit boards by myself?

Yes, if you are experienced with DIY home repairs and feel comfy operating at heights. Nevertheless, working with a professional makes sure a more secure and dependable installation.

3. Exist any advantages to vented soffit boards?

Yes, vented soffits offer improved air blood circulation in the attic, which assists to manage temperature level and lower wetness accumulation, ultimately safeguarding your roofing system and eaves.

4. How can I inform if the soffits are vented or not?

Vented soffits will have little holes or vents that permit airflow. You might also consult your home's blueprints or building and construction files for additional information.

5. Do soffit boards affect home energy efficiency?

Yes, proper installation and maintenance of soffit boards can boost ventilation, improve energy performance, and potentially lower cooling and heating expenses.
